" You know the cockpit is something that is often overlooked on a sail boat. Crew placement, the location of hardware, the easy access to equipment that you need is critical when you are sailing. A lot of time when people are in high winds or in congestive situations, they may need to move in a hurry. If you are dealing with spaghetti like this, you are going to have problems. Its a recommendation for your crew to be in a good out of the way location. In this particular boat, the swing of the tiller is so big the crew would generally, would have to sit aft of the skipper for easy movement of the tiller. If you add on a tiller extension, it gets even worst. So you really want to have a plan about where people are suppose to be if you are in heavy air situation. "
